common/version.go (86 lines of code) (raw):

package common import ( "fmt" "runtime" "time" "github.com/prometheus/client_golang/prometheus" "github.com/urfave/cli" ) var NAME = "gitlab-ci-multi-runner" var VERSION = "dev" var REVISION = "HEAD" var BRANCH = "HEAD" var BUILT = "now" var AppVersion AppVersionInfo type AppVersionInfo struct { Name string `json:"name"` Version string `json:"version"` Revision string `json:"revision"` Branch string `json:"branch"` GOVersion string `json:"go_version"` BuiltAt time.Time `json:"built_at"` OS string `json:"os"` Architecture string `json:"architecture"` } func (v *AppVersionInfo) Printer(c *cli.Context) { fmt.Print(v.Extended()) } func (v *AppVersionInfo) Line() string { return fmt.Sprintf("%s %s (%s)", v.Name, v.Version, v.Revision) } func (v *AppVersionInfo) ShortLine() string { return fmt.Sprintf("%s (%s)", v.Version, v.Revision) } func (v *AppVersionInfo) UserAgent() string { return fmt.Sprintf("%s %s (%s; %s; %s/%s)", v.Name, v.Version, v.Branch, v.GOVersion, v.OS, v.Architecture) } func (v *AppVersionInfo) Extended() string { version := fmt.Sprintf("Version: %s\n", v.Version) version += fmt.Sprintf("Git revision: %s\n", v.Revision) version += fmt.Sprintf("Git branch: %s\n", v.Branch) version += fmt.Sprintf("GO version: %s\n", v.GOVersion) version += fmt.Sprintf("Built: %s\n", v.BuiltAt.Format(time.RFC1123Z)) version += fmt.Sprintf("OS/Arch: %s/%s\n", v.OS, v.Architecture) return version } // NewMetricsCollector returns a prometheus.Collector which represents current build information. func (v *AppVersionInfo) NewMetricsCollector() *prometheus.GaugeVec { labels := map[string]string{ "name": v.Name, "version": v.Version, "revision": v.Revision, "branch": v.Branch, "go_version": v.GOVersion, "built_at": v.BuiltAt.String(), "os": v.OS, "architecture": v.Architecture, } labelNames := make([]string, 0, len(labels)) for n := range labels { labelNames = append(labelNames, n) } buildInfo := prometheus.NewGaugeVec( prometheus.GaugeOpts{ Name: "ci_runner_version_info", Help: "A metric with a constant '1' value labeled by different build stats fields.", }, labelNames, ) buildInfo.With(labels).Set(1) return buildInfo } func init() { builtAt := time.Now() if BUILT != "now" { builtAt, _ = time.Parse(time.RFC3339, BUILT) } AppVersion = AppVersionInfo{ Name: NAME, Version: VERSION, Revision: REVISION, Branch: BRANCH, GOVersion: runtime.Version(), BuiltAt: builtAt, OS: runtime.GOOS, Architecture: runtime.GOARCH, } }
